Flowers from a Puritan's Garden

Spurgeon

Spurgeon's 1883 collection of meditations drawn from the metaphors and illustrations found throughout the twenty-two volumes of Thomas Manton's works. Spurgeon culled the best figures from Manton's sermons and composed brief devotional reflections around them, presenting Puritan wisdom in an accessible and edifying form for private worship.
